Mike Ravelli was born December 17, 1983 in Haarlem, the Netherlands. Overwhelmed by the continuous, monotone motion of the early Detroit sound, Mike wanted to know more and get closer to the wonderfull world of music.
Without even having DJ equipment, Mike started frequenting the local record store, listening and buying records from techno artists like Richie Hawtin, Gaetano Parisio and Ben Sims. At the age of 17, Mike managed to move to a place for his own. In his small room, he quickly bought the equipment he needed to let his DJ career take off.
With invitations in small bars and parties at friends places, he managed to bring his music out in the open very quickly.
Appearing on the legendary GZG Familieweekend in the summer of 2005, he entered a new phase in his life as a DJ. With his six-hour marathon set he surpluses all expectations, claiming a place as a DJ in the Gasten Zonder Grenzen collective, widely known for their wild (after) parties in the area of Amsterdam. As a partner of underground heroes like Ille Bitch and De Man Zonder Schaduw, he now found his own space in the Dutch scene.
The year 2006 was a complete turn around for Mike. After playing in several clubs and venue's, other people started to see his talents as well. This resulted not only in having a residency for Club Stalker and GZG, but international gigs followed as well. Mike is also playing weekly on a global radio station, www.livesets.com. Overwhelmed by this succes he felt in love with the great feeling of controling, manipulating the crowds. Being only twenty three years of age, there are lot of things yet to discover...
